Transaction 580894fc995be447c63db835c8eb2374ab2ac1e403559c3c8efe94a0ebaba9f5

1 Input
2 Outputs
  • 580894fc995be447c63db835c8eb2374ab2ac1e403559c3c8efe94a0ebaba9f5:0
  • value  1000000
    address  2NBMEX4Rdr3bbvzNvakogA33BVj6NaAs1Ry
  • 580894fc995be447c63db835c8eb2374ab2ac1e403559c3c8efe94a0ebaba9f5:1
  • value  1398886
    address  2NA2AjaQMK2zehbRFvFB8ynTEUZDRVMrzFd